Output 8de1fa4feacab73a31d9494135c180ff5a652c1ab4c8bb34c8b1454690e94917:2

value
6024067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c779c4bc2f065aef623f6767ec94d78dd405fb OP_EQUAL
address
3CyVzx669TE2HHF2afCmbN8YpebwpyzqPq
transaction
8de1fa4feacab73a31d9494135c180ff5a652c1ab4c8bb34c8b1454690e94917
spent
true